General Description
EP (epoxy resin) is a type of thermosetting polymer that is commonly used in a variety of applications, including coatings, adhesives, and composite materials. It is composed of two main components: an epoxy resin and a curing agent. When these two components are mixed together, a chemical reaction takes place that results in the formation of a cross-linked network, which gives the material its strong and durable properties. EP resins are known for their excellent adhesion, high chemical and temperature resistance, and good electrical insulation properties, making them ideal for applications in industries such as aerospace, automotive, construction, and electronics. Overall, EP resins are valued for their versatility and strength in a range of industrial and commercial uses.
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 38891-59-7 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 3,8,8,9 and 1 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 5 and 9 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 38891-59:
(7*3)+(6*8)+(5*8)+(4*9)+(3*1)+(2*5)+(1*9)=167
167 % 10 = 7
So 38891-59-7 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
